The Regulatory Maze and Its Impact

One of the less glamorous yet vital parts of top betting sites is their relationship with regulators. Depending on the jurisdiction—be it Malta, the UK, or Curacao—platforms must meet diverse licensing requirements. These rules often determine how a site handles player security, data privacy, and payout fairness.

For example, most reputable sites today employ SSL encryption to protect user data and work with trusted payment methods like PayPal, Skrill, or traditional bank transfers. This layer of security is essential, especially when real money changes hands frequently.

It’s easy to overlook these details, but they are the backbone of trust in an industry that thrives on confidence. After all, who wants to gamble on a platform that might not honor winnings or expose their personal information?

Behind the Screens: The Technology Powering the Experience

Technology is the silent force allowing millions to bet online every day. Random Number Generators (RNGs) ensure fairness in virtual roulette or slot games like Starburst and Book of Dead, while live streaming technology powers real-time interactions with dealers and other players. These components require significant investment and expertise.

Moreover, mobile compatibility has become non-negotiable. Platforms built on HTML5 frameworks deliver smooth experiences across devices. Some even incorporate biometric logins and AI-driven customer service bots to streamline operations.

Interestingly, many users fail to appreciate the complexity behind these features. It’s not just about flashy graphics or bonuses; it’s about the delicate balance between innovation and reliability.

Responsible Betting: A Quiet Priority

It’s impossible to discuss betting sites without acknowledging the importance of responsible gambling. While these platforms offer entertainment and potential rewards, they also carry risks of addiction and financial loss. Most established sites provide tools like de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ations. Users should take advantage of these resources.

On my end, I believe transparency and education are key. The better informed bettors are, the more likely they will engage safely and enjoy the experience without adverse consequences.
